NXTGEN is working with a prestigious Cambridge College to recruit an Accounts Assistant, a key role within their Finance Office. This position is instrumental in ensuring accurate and timely financial administration, supporting the College's ability to make informed decisions based on reliable accounting information.

Reporting to the Accounts Payable and Receivable Supervisor, the successful candidate will manage the Accounts Receivable function while providing general financial administration support to the team.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Issue invoices for conference activity, internal department charges, and ad hoc income, ensuring VAT compliance and account reconciliations.

  • Manage credit control processes, including timely collection of outstanding payments and maintaining compliance with credit terms.

  • Perform bank reconciliations for multiple accounts, posting journals, and ensuring accurate account allocations.

  • Update and maintain customer and supplier records, including processing new supplier checks and adding accounts to the finance system.

  • Support broader financial administration tasks, including managing purchase orders, posting credit card expenditure, and overseeing Finance Office email inboxes.

The ideal candidate will have a strong background in accounts receivable, credit control, or a similar financial administration role, combined with excellent organisational and time management skills and a keen eye for detail. A proactive and flexible approach is essential, as is the ability to support team members in a collaborative environment. Familiarity with finance software systems and general ledger maintenance would be advantageous.
